Обмен сообщениями Google

В этом разделе содержатся руководства по реализации приложений Xamarin.Android с помощью служб обмена сообщениями Google.

Firebase Cloud Messaging

Firebase Cloud Messaging (FCM) — это служба, которая упрощает обмен сообщениями между мобильными приложениями и серверными приложениями. FCM является преемником Google Cloud Messaging. В этой статье представлен обзор работы FCM и пошаговые процедуры получения учетных данных, чтобы приложение пользовалось службами FCM.

Удаленные уведомления с помощью Firebase Cloud Messaging

В этом пошаговом руководстве показано, как использовать Firebase Cloud Messaging для реализации удаленных уведомлений (также называемых push-уведомлениями) в приложении Xamarin.Android. В нем показано, как реализовать различные классы, необходимые для обмена данными с Firebase Cloud Messaging (FCM), в примерах настройки манифеста Android для доступа к FCM и демонстрации нижестоящего обмена сообщениями с помощью консоли Firebase.

Google Cloud Messaging

В этом разделе представлен общий обзор того, как Google Cloud Messaging (GCM) направляет сообщения между приложением и сервером приложений, а также предоставляет пошаговую процедуру получения учетных данных, чтобы приложение пользовалось службами GCM. (Обратите внимание, что GCM был заменен FCM.)

Примечание.

GCM был заменен Firebase Cloud Messaging (FCM). Сервер GCM и клиентские API устарели и больше не будут доступны как только 11 апреля 2019 г.

Удаленные уведомления с помощью Google Cloud Messaging

В этом разделе описано, как реализовать удаленные уведомления в Xamarin.Android с помощью Google Cloud Messaging. В нем описываются различные компоненты, которые необходимо использовать для включения Google Cloud Messaging в приложении Android.